Overview: Train from Newbury to Bournemouth
Trains from Newbury to Bournemouth run on average 5 times per day, taking around 1h 49m. Cheap train tickets for this journey start at £96 if you book in advance.
The earliest train runs at 05:11, the last at 22:47. The fastest train covers the 85 km distance in 2h 28m.
